Introduction: Llc Real Estate Investment

An LLC, or Limited Liability Company, is a popular legal structure for real estate investors because it offers a number of benefits, including:

  • Limited liability: An LLC protects its owners from personal liability for the debts and liabilities of the business.
  • Pass-through taxation: LLCs are taxed as pass-through entities, meaning that the profits and losses of the business are passed through to the owners and reported on their individual tax returns.
  • Flexibility: LLCs offer a great deal of flexibility in terms of how they are structured and operated.

Benefits of Investing in Real Estate Through an LLC

There are a number of benefits to investing in real estate through an LLC, including:

  • Tax benefits: LLCs can take advantage of a number of tax benefits, including the ability to deduct mortgage interest and depreciation.
  • Asset protection: An LLC can help to protect your personal assets from being seized by creditors.
  • Privacy: LLCs can help to keep your personal information private.

Types of LLC Real Estate Investments

Investing in real estate through a limited liability company (LLC) offers numerous benefits, including liability protection, tax advantages, and flexibility. LLCs can invest in various types of real estate, each with its own characteristics and potential returns.

Rental Properties

Rental properties are a popular investment choice for LLCs. They provide a steady stream of income through rent payments and can appreciate in value over time. Rental properties can include single-family homes, apartments, and commercial spaces leased to tenants.

Commercial Properties

Commercial properties are designed for business use, such as office buildings, retail stores, and industrial warehouses. Investing in commercial properties can offer higher rental income than residential properties but may also involve higher operating costs and management responsibilities.

Land Development

Land development involves acquiring raw land and developing it for residential, commercial, or industrial use. This type of investment can be more complex and time-consuming than other real estate investments but has the potential for significant returns if executed successfully.

How to Form an LLC for Real Estate Investment

Forming an LLC (Limited Liability Company) for real estate investment provides several benefits, including liability protection, tax advantages, and flexibility. Here are the steps involved in forming an LLC for real estate investment:

Choose a Business Name

Select a name that clearly reflects the purpose of your LLC and is not already in use by another business. Check the availability of your desired name with the state’s business registration agency.

File Articles of Organization

Prepare and file Articles of Organization with the state’s business registration agency. This document Artikels the basic information about your LLC, such as its name, registered agent, and purpose.

Obtain an EIN

Apply for an Employer Identification Number (EIN) from the Internal Revenue Service (IRS). This number is used to identify your LLC for tax purposes.

Open a Business Bank Account

Establish a dedicated business bank account for your LLC. This account will separate your personal finances from your business transactions.

Tax Implications of LLC Real Estate Investments

LLCs offer unique tax benefits for real estate investments. Unlike corporations, LLCs are pass-through entities, meaning that their profits and losses are passed directly to the individual members. This can provide significant tax savings, as it allows investors to avoid double taxation.

Pass-through Taxation

Pass-through taxation means that the LLC’s income and expenses are not taxed at the corporate level. Instead, the profits and losses are reported on the individual members’ tax returns. This can be beneficial for investors who want to avoid the high corporate tax rates.

Depreciation Deductions, Llc real estate investment

Depreciation deductions allow investors to deduct the cost of their real estate investments over time. This can help to reduce their taxable income and increase their cash flow. LLCs can take advantage of depreciation deductions just like any other type of business entity.

Legal Considerations for LLC Real Estate Investments

When forming an LLC for real estate investment, it’s essential to consider various legal aspects that impact liability protection, contractual obligations, and insurance requirements.

LLCs offer limited liability protection to their owners, meaning that their personal assets are generally shielded from liabilities incurred by the LLC. This protection is crucial for real estate investments, as it helps mitigate risks associated with property ownership, such as lawsuits or financial losses.

Contractual Obligations

LLCs are separate legal entities, and as such, they are responsible for fulfilling their own contractual obligations. When entering into contracts related to real estate investments, such as purchase agreements, lease agreements, or property management contracts, it’s essential to ensure that the LLC is clearly identified as the party to the contract.

This helps establish the LLC’s liability and prevents personal liability for the owners.

Insurance Requirements

Real estate investments often require various types of insurance, such as property insurance, liability insurance, and title insurance. It’s the responsibility of the LLC to obtain and maintain adequate insurance coverage to protect its assets and interests. Proper insurance can help mitigate financial risks and provide peace of mind in the event of unforeseen circumstances.

Tips for Successful LLC Real Estate Investments

Investing in real estate through an LLC can be a lucrative endeavor, but it’s crucial to approach it strategically to maximize your chances of success. Here are some essential tips to guide you:

Conduct Thorough Market Research

Before diving into real estate investments, it’s imperative to conduct thorough market research to understand the local real estate landscape, including factors such as property values, rental rates, vacancy rates, and economic indicators. This information will help you make informed decisions about your investment strategy and identify areas with strong potential for appreciation and rental income.

Develop a Business Plan

A well-crafted business plan is essential for guiding your LLC’s real estate investments. It should Artikel your investment goals, target market, property acquisition strategy, financing options, and exit strategy. Having a clear plan will keep you focused and organized throughout the investment process.

Secure Financing

Financing is often necessary to acquire investment properties. Explore various financing options, such as traditional bank loans, private lenders, or hard money loans. Consider the interest rates, loan terms, and closing costs associated with each option to determine the most suitable financing for your LLC’s needs.

Hire a Qualified Property Manager

If you’re not planning to manage the properties yourself, hiring a qualified property manager is crucial. A good property manager will handle tasks such as tenant screening, rent collection, maintenance, and repairs, freeing up your time and ensuring the smooth operation of your investments.
